I Remember...

Because I have dated Chris since I was 14 years old, I've known Ron for quite some time - in fact, he was the one who drove Chris to come see me for the first time at my parents house in 1996. Especially when we were younger, Ron would take us to dinner at cool places and involve us in things he and Chris shared an interest in; the Boat Show at the Convention Center, The Burnet Senior Golf Classic, Hunting and Fishing Expos. I always admired the way he was so excited to show what he loved to Chris (and me).

Chris and I have grown up together, and I've been there to witness the relationship between him and his father. Whenever Chris needed to talk or advice, he could call his dad and pretty much no matter what Ron was doing, he would answer. At the end of every conversation, they were sure to say "I love you" That is pretty amazing stuff considering they were men, and men aren't always openly affectionate. I always admired Ron for showing Chris that kind of love - I know it makes him a great husband to me and I know it will make him an amazing dad in the future.

At our wedding in March, Ron was able to make the drive from Colorado to Chaska which meant so much to both of us. He gave an emotional and heartfelt toast and it was such a wonderful memory that I (and Chris) will always cherish.
Ron's death was so sudden and shocking and, to put it simply, just so sad. I feel such a sadness for Chris and for me, as well as the grandkids in the future that Ron will never get to meet. I feel sad for the many friends all over the country who can attest to the man he was.

Ron was such a kind person and deserved to get to live out his life on earth - moving back to MN after years of being away. Selfishly, it is human nature to have regrets and want him here with us, but I know he is in heaven looking down on us.

We want to celebrate Ron and the impact he had on our lives and look forward to sharing that celebration in a memorial services to be held after the first of the year. (Details forthcoming)

We thank you all for your prayers and for your kind words during this difficult time. We too extend our sympathy to all of you who were caring friends and loved ones of Ron.
